Re: date formatting in the Ostrell checkout summary — please don't hand-roll the formats. We localize via the Fennic locale service, which picks patterns per region and falls back to ISO when a locale is missing. Your change hardcodes day-first ordering, which breaks for about a third of our markets. Swap it for `fennic.formatDate()` and pass the user's locale token. The cache and fallback knobs it reads are defined here.

tuning constants:
QUOTAS = {
    "druwyn": 5,
    "holix": 5,
    "zorath": 5,
    "holwyn": 10,
}

Session Handling: Snapshot Testing UI Components

Our Lintberry snapshot suite renders components inside a mocked session so auth-gated widgets don't flake. New hires: never record snapshots against a live session, since tokens rotate nightly and diffs will churn. The fixture harness injects a stable test session automatically. For local runs against the mock gateway, use the bearer token below.

session JWT of yawep-yawep = eyJhbGciOiJIUzI1NiIsInR5cCI6IkpXVCJ9.eyJzdWIiOiI3pWF3_In0.aXYsHiog

When a customer reports OOM kills on the Ketterly inference tier, attach `vramscope` to the affected pod. Set `VRAMSCOPE_INTERVAL_MS=500` and `VRAMSCOPE_MAX_SNAPSHOTS=120` in the pod's env file; higher frequencies distort allocator behavior and make traces useless. Snapshots land in the shared diagnostics volume and are rotated hourly. Do not run the profiler on more than two pods per node. Uploading snapshots to the triage service requires its access token in the env file, placed on the line that follows.

sealed setting: RELAY_SECRET5=82864

Changed defaults for the Soundmarsh audio waveform preview renderer. Peak sampling now defaults to 1024 buckets (was 512); previews looked blocky on long podcast files. Default color ramp switched to mono; the gradient was costing a render pass. Client-side caching now on by default. No API changes — existing callers passing explicit options are unaffected. Tests updated in the renderer suite; snapshot diffs are expected and large. Review the new defaults against the old baseline. The updated default config follows below.

config for yajep-tafof:
[rusath]
team = julmir
access_code = ac_fe37fd
host = rusath.novactech.test
port = 8000
owner = pelmir.weneth
peer = oliwyn.olvarqdyn.internal